Windham Low Two-Door Cabinet

Traditional Arts and Crafts cabinetry gets a modern makeover in black lacquer. Multi-unit storage collection has tempered glass pane doors, handsomely fitted with antiqued bronze pulls. -Solid hardwood legs and frames with engineered wood panels -Tempered glass -Black lacquer finish -Antiqued bronze hardware -Two shelves (one adjustable) -See dimensions below

"We purchased this piece in black to use as a china cabinet for our smallish dining room and are very pleased with its style, size, quality, and capacity. Our white bone china looks particularly impressive against the black lacquer finish, but darker colors and crystal tend to be less noticeable. The arts and crafts details make an otherwise contemporary piece seem more transitional/traditional, and it would easily be at home in several different rooms. The storage capacity is amazing for a piece this size, and the 3/4 inch MDF shelves are quite sturdy. We have 13 five-piece place settings, numerous china and stoneware serving pieces, tons of crystal vases, candlesticks, wine carafes, and other table top odds and ends, plus a full flatware chest, all stored inside, with room to spare. Assembly was relatively easy and took roughly 2.5 hours including a quick break for lunch.
Some issues to note: First, it did take 2 people for a few of the steps, as the directions indicate, so do not attempt putting this together solo. Second, the hardware is antiqued bronze, but I would not say that a "warm" bronze tone is the predominate color. Rather, it very antiqued in a dark, cool finish. However, the hardware color works well with the brushed and antiqued nickel hardware on our other furniture, so this is not a drawback for us. Last, there is a moderate off-gassing odor that is beginning to fade away after having the cabinet for over two weeks. I have left the doors open for several hours each day to help it continue to evaporate, but we have no children or pets to worry about. Hopefully, the smell will go away completely over time.
This cabinet easily rivals much more pricey furniture, as others have noted, and is an excellent value. Besides the minor issues noted above, I highly recommend it."
